@Topic - I don't think Collective Unconsciousness is useless, but it certainly is quite limited when compared to the its counterparts - Asylum and Sacred Soil - namely because it restricts the caster from doing anything in the mean time. I would've much preferred it to be a bubble that is dropped around the AST upon use but didn't restrict them. That or boost the Noct version of Collective Unconsciousness in the same way they did the Diurnal version (that delicious 200 potency/tick heal) and make it 15% or something to that effect. Collective Unconsciousness should be more powerful than their WHM and SCH equivalents if they wish to fully and completely restrict the caster in the process.

That tooltip is for other ground based abilities that the same caster has. So a SCH can't have both Sacred Soil and Shadow Flare up, but Asylum and Sacred Soil can both be up at the same time as they come from two different sources.
